Skip to main content

Haloo semua mav ya,,, aq mau tanya..?

June 29, 2011 by novinaldi

novinaldi's picture

gimana ya cara insert data tanggal(date) ??
bentuk script model dan controller nya gmana ?? please ya,, help me...

klo bentuk model yang aq buat kayak gini scriptnya..

function addpeminjaman($kodebuku,$idanggota)
{
$tglhrskembali = array('tglhrskembali'=>date('yyyymmdd', strtotime($this->input->post('tglhrskembali')))) ;

$this->db->query(" INSERT INTO pinjam (idanggota,kodebuku,tglpinjam,tglhrskembali) VALUES ('$idanggota','$kodebuku',now(),'$tglhrskembali') ");

}

ketika mau di simpan cuman data tanggalharuskembalinya nggak masuk, isi nya gini '0000-00-00'.

mohon donk pencerahannya...!!!

makasih ya sebelumnya....

wassalaman.....

Comments

Comment viewing options

Select your preferred way to display the comments and click "Save settings" to activate your changes.

BLS:

June 30, 2011 by syabac, 19 hours 39 min ago
Comment: 8458

syabac's picture

itu code punya anda:

$tglhrskembali = array('tglhrskembali'=>date('yyyymmdd', strtotime($this->input->post('tglhrskembali')))) ;
... . .. 
.. . . 
$this->db->query(" INSERT INTO pinjam (idanggota,kodebuku,tglpinjam,tglhrskembali) VALUES ('$idanggota','$kodebuku',now(),'$tglhrskembali') ");

seharusnya:

//tglhrskembali jangan berupa array.
$tglhrskembali = date('y/m/d', strtotime($this->input->post('tglhrskembali'));
$this->db->insert('pinjam', array(
   'idanggota' => $idanggota,
   'kodebuku'  => $kodebuku,
   'tglpinjam' => date('y/m/d'),
   'tglhrskembali' => $tglhrskembali
));

makasih ya mas..

July 1, 2011 by novinaldi, 4 hours 49 min ago
Comment: 8469

novinaldi's picture

saya coba dulu ya.... mudah2an ja bisa. !!!

nggak salah kq..

June 30, 2011 by novinaldi, 22 hours 25 min ago
Comment: 8457

novinaldi's picture

script tu betul juga,, makasih ya dan kasih masukkan dikit.

tapi klo saya tanggal nya di inputkan.

gmana y,bingung saya jadix. klo da yang lain?? please help me

Coba Jawab Ya..!!!

June 29, 2011 by jhono, 1 day 8 hours ago
Comment: 8452

jhono's picture

Sama kayak punya saya,tapi saya coba begini:misal tanggal yang diinput itu mengambil dari tanggal komputer(sistem),saya langsung memasukan variabel $tgl di model.kurang lebih begini.

function tambah_data($data){//$data ini diparsing dari controller
$data['tgl'] = date("Y-m-d");
$this->db->insert('nama_tabel',$data);
return;
}

maaf jika salah.

Premium Drupal Themes by Adaptivethemes